Company Description

Sika is a speciality chemicals company with a globally leading position in the development and production of systems and products for bonding, sealing, damping, reinforcing, and protection in the building sector and industrial manufacturing. Sika has subsidiaries in 102 countries around the world and, in over 400 factories, produces innovative technologies for customers worldwide. In doing so, it plays a crucial role in enabling the transformation of the construction and transportation sector towards greater environmental compatibility. With more than 34,000 employees, the company generated sales of CHF 11.76 billion in 2024.

Job Description

Job Purpose

The Automation Maintenance Engineer is responsible for ensuring the safe, reliable, and efficient operation of the plant’s automation, electrical control, and instrumentation systems.

The role performs preventive, predictive, and corrective maintenance; diagnoses and resolves automation-related failures; and implements reliability improvements to minimize unplanned downtime. All automation activities must be completed in accordance with Sika HSE requirements, engineering standards, change-control procedures, quality requirements, and applicable legal regulations.

PLC, HMI, and Control-System Management

  • Support troubleshooting, diagnostics, and approved modifications of PLC and HMI systems.
  • Perform minor PLC logic modifications, HMI updates, and drive parameter adjustments when required and within the assigned authority.
  • Ensure that all software and parameter changes are tested, documented, reviewed, and approved in accordance with the plant’s management-of-change procedure.
  • Maintain controlled backups of PLC programs, HMI applications, drive parameters, configuration files, and other critical automation software.
  • Ensure that the latest approved versions can be identified and safely restored when required.
  • Prevent unauthorized modifications to automation software, system configurations, or equipment parameters.
  • Maintain accurate documentation of control logic, system architecture, network configuration, and approved software changes.

Key Performance Indicators

Performance may be measured against the following indicators:

  • Automation-related equipment availability
  • Unplanned automation and control-system downtime
  • Mean time between failures
  • Mean time to repair
  • Preventive maintenance completion rate
  • Recurring breakdown reduction
  • Response time to equipment failures
  • Accuracy and completeness of maintenance records
  • Availability of critical automation spare parts
  • PLC and HMI backup compliance
  • Calibration and inspection completion
  • Corrective-action closure rate
  • Maintenance cost and spare-parts consumption
  • HSE compliance and safe-work performance
  • Completion and effectiveness of reliability improvements
